Argentina: Cafe Tortoni

cafetortoni-1.jpg

I'm trying to speed these up so I can finish them off at the same time I'm building up a backlog of NYC photos. Cafe Tortoni is the famous cafe near the main square. It certainly was a nice cafe, but I think we were starting to get tired of the city at this point and looking forward to the jungle.

The tea and hot chocolate were tasty, especially with the churros you were encouraged to cover in sugar and dip in.
